Output 8ccd6e55de841895cb54b50b87f7028cd1854561d2b945b5f7c5f84400dadca3:3

value
659967736
script pubkey
OP_0 OP_PUSHBYTES_20 f55b792bf6ba705a0eb1dfbbb67db1d296b4e975
address
bc1q74dhj2lkhfc95r43m7amvld362ttf6t469z7fl
transaction
8ccd6e55de841895cb54b50b87f7028cd1854561d2b945b5f7c5f84400dadca3
confirmations
152258
spent
true